EUVDB-ID: #VU8057
Risk: Medium
CVSSv4.0: 7 [CVSS:4.0/AV:N/AC:L/AT:N/PR:L/UI:A/VC:H/VI:H/VA:N/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N/E:P/U:Green]
CVE-ID: CVE-2017-0901
CWE-ID:
CWE-20 - Improper input validation
Exploit availability: Yes
DescriptionThe vulnerability allows a remote attacker to overwrite arbitrary files on the target system.
The weakness exists due to insufficient validation of user-supplied input. A remote attacker can trick the victim into installing a specially crafted RubyGem and overwrite arbitrary files.
Update the affected packages.
dev-ruby/rubygems to version: 2.6.13
